About this listen

Featuring 21 different voices hailing from five different countries and 11 states, Ghosts, Goblins, Murder, and Madness is certain to strike a chord with every horror aficionado.

Devil's Night, Day of the Dead, and Halloween have been celebrated around the world in one form or another, beginning with the ancient Celts more than 2,000 years ago. For some revelers, it's a time for guising, or dressing up in elaborate costume; for others, it's a time for practical jokes and mischief; and for some, it's a reverent occasion to acknowledge the thin line between earth and the spirit world.

In this same vein, the stories in this collection provide a wide-angle lens at what comprises the unique expanse of horror fiction today. From hobgoblins and apparitions, to haunted dwellings and cursed possessions, to good intentions gone awry and evil ones turned on the perpetrator, these 20 tales will unsettle, frighten, tickle, and caution, and in the end, listeners may take heed before ever again accompanying their children trick-or-treating, striking up conversations in anonymous chat rooms, or fortifying their homes in an attempt to prevent Halloween vandalism.
